Friendship is one of the most beautiful things in life. Everybody deserves and even needs a friend. Especially if that friend is like Blobby the Blob Fish, who, as one of the creators has put it, is "the magical best friend you always wished you had".

Friends provide a comfortable oasis for all of the bad things that constantly happen in our lives. From little disappointments right down to injustice, there's plenty of unjust stuff going on, and it's important that somebody should share it, especially if it's done between friends, in a safe environment. There is such a hospitable environment, and there are social issues being constantly brought up in the friend circle of Blobby & Friends, a comic that masterfully ties these two things together.

Don't know about you, but didn't you notice how detailed the visual style is, how well-drawn and fleshed out the graphics and the characters are? Well, a whole team is working behind each and every comic, and this collective collaboration really shows, considering the output and the quality of each individual panel and the comic strip in general. In a sense, these collective hours of hard work have paid off, and they bask in the glory of over half a million followers on Instagram, which is A LOT by any standards. And the fact that this project has worked so well is really awesome! "To be honest, we didn't expect things to go the way they did and I am full of love and gratitude towards our audience."

As you noticed, Blobby is the glue (or the blob) that holds the team together, but other characters also deserve to be mentioned. "[Other folks] who appear in the comics are Lily, their human friend (and I really relate to her character a lot, I'm not sure why), Ashley, who is Lily's crush, and Charlie / Punk Kid who can come off as intimidating but is really the most soft and wholesome character we've ever come up with. That's why Charlie is modeling our underwear," Zack said, laughing.

In the previous post, Zack, one of the authors of the comic, has given an interview explaining the mysterious circumstances of the comic's origin and how they're doing as of right now. "I don't know if there's one thing that inspired me to start the comics in the way that it exists today. We actually started with something really simple, with funny and cute gags that were more at the surface level. As the account grew, we realized we had an opportunity to use Blobby to speak up about more serious topics," Zack explained. "Listening to the reactions from our followers also made a huge difference for us. I can speak only for myself but I really feel like I’ve personally grown with this world we've created."
